{"product_id":"9781455623976","title":"Ruth Asawa : A Sculpting Life","description":"Ruth Asawa (1926-2013) was an American sculptor known in San Francisco as the “fountain lady,” for her many works displayed around the city. Her pieces are also included in the collections of the Guggenheim and Whitney museums in New York. This biography introduces her to young readers, moving from her carefree childhood in Southern California to her life in a Japanese internment camp to her great achievements as a talented artist and teacher.","brand":"Arcadia Pub","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47027118670064,"sku":"9781455623976","price":16.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0737\/7593\/9824\/files\/9781455623976_p0.jpg?v=1769909434","url":"https:\/\/shop-qa.barnesandnoble.com\/products\/9781455623976","provider":"Barnes \u0026 Noble (DEV)","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
